Masonry Wall Installation in Boston, MA
Masonry wall installation services involve constructing durable and attractive walls using materials such as brick, stone, or concrete blocks. These walls can serve various purposes, including creating privacy boundaries, enhancing landscape features, supporting retaining walls, or framing outdoor living spaces. Property owners often seek these services for both functional and aesthetic reasons, aiming to improve the value and appearance of their properties through well-built, long-lasting structures.
Before requesting masonry wall installation, property owners typically want to understand the types of materials suitable for their project, the overall design options available, and the expected durability of different wall styles. It’s also helpful to consider factors such as the intended use of the wall, local building codes, and any necessary permits. Clear communication about project scope and desired outcomes ensures the installation process aligns with property goals and results in a structure that meets both practical needs and visual preferences.

Common Masonry Wall Installation Jobs
Retaining Walls - designed to hold back soil and create level outdoor spaces.
Garden Walls - enhance landscape aesthetics and define planting areas.
Fireplace and Chimney Masonry - build durable, functional outdoor or indoor fireplaces.
Boundary Walls - provide privacy and security around residential properties.
Pillar and Column Installations - add structural support and decorative accents to entryways.
Repair and Restoration - restore damaged or aging masonry to improve safety and appearance.
Masonry Wall Installation Questions
What types of masonry walls are commonly installed? Typical masonry walls include brick, stone, and concrete block walls for various purposes like boundaries and support structures.
What should property owners consider before installing a masonry wall? It's important to assess the purpose, location, and local building codes to ensure proper planning and compliance.
Are there different styles available for masonry wall installation? Yes, options range from traditional stacked patterns to decorative designs, allowing customization to match property aesthetics.
What maintenance is required for masonry walls? Regular inspection for cracks or damage and cleaning to remove dirt or moss help maintain the wall’s integrity and appearance.
